N.J.S.A. 34:12-3

Employer shall not require employees to renounce membership in or refrain from joining society or brotherhood

34:12-3. Employer shall not require employees to renounce membership in or refrain from joining society or brotherhood No corporation doing business in this state shall require directly or indirectly that any individuals shall either individually or collectively, in any manner promise to renounce existing membership in a lodge, brotherhood, or labor organization of any kind, or promise to refrain from joining any such lodge, brotherhood, or organization at any future time.
